这些面试题你都会了吗?(精选97道Java核心面试题)常量池有哪些,数据结构,自己设计一个常量池String为啥设计为final,好处是啥,其中equals方法如何实现jdk序列化怎么实现,有测试过他性能吗,serialVersionUID作用是什么,用过一些其他序列化方式没,为什么需要序列化这个技术hashmap1.7 和 1.8区别 hashmap怎么解决hash冲突 查询时间复杂
一条更新SQL执行流程更新语句整体流程连接数据库清空当前表对应所有缓存分析器分析词法和语法优化器决定使用什么索引执行器负责具体执行重要日志模块:redo logMySQLWAL技术全称是Write-Ahead LoggingInnoDB 引擎特有的日志先写日志,再写磁盘详解如下:1、当有一条记录需要更新时候,InnoDB引擎就会把记录写到redo log里面,并且更新内存 2、Inno
转载 2023-08-24 23:06:00
0阅读
<!-- GFM-TOC --> * [一、基础](#一基础) * [二、创建表](#二创建表) * [三、修改表](#三修改表) * [四、插入](#四插入) * [五、更新](#五更新) * [六、删除](#六删除) * [七、查询](#七查询) * [八、排序](#八排序) * [九、过滤](#九过滤) * [十、通配符](#十通配符) * [十一、计算字段](#十一计算字段)
转载 2024-08-06 08:24:21
62阅读
一、回顾一条查询语句执行过程一条查询语句执行过程一般是经过连接器、分析器、优化器、执行器等阶段后,最后到达存储引擎。二、更新语句执行过程更新SQL语句执行过程与查询基本一致。通过分析器词法和语法解析判断出是一条更新语句,优化器决定使用索引等,执行器负责具体执行,找到数据行后进行更新更新语句执行流程涉及到两个重要日志模块——redo log(重做日志) 和 binglog(归档日
转载 2024-06-20 17:45:31
27阅读
1.含有某串字母字段替换:update imagetable set imageID = replace(imageID, 'ZH0211001', 'ZH4111001') 只要imageID含有“ZH0211001”,都替换为“ZH4111001”。2.16gb表,大概有73万条数据,耗时10分钟。 
转载 2023-06-19 09:59:55
277阅读
MySQL数据库之UPDATE更新语句精解(1)用于操作数据库SQL一般分为两种,一种是查询语句,也就是我们所说SELECT语句,另外一种就是更新语句,也叫做数据操作语句。本文以MySQL为背景来讨论如何使有SQL中更新语句。一、INSERT和REPLACEINSERT和REPLACE语句功能都是向表中插入新数据。这两条语句语法类似。它们主要区别是如何处理重复数据。1. INSER
转载 2023-05-18 12:58:57
1115阅读
# 了解MySQL更新SQL语句MySQL数据库中,更新数据是一项常见操作。通过更新SQL语句,我们可以修改表中数据,使其符合特定要求或者更新为新数值。本文将介绍MySQL更新SQL语句基本语法、常见用法以及一些注意事项。 ## 更新SQL语句基本语法 更新数据SQL语句基本语法如下: ```sql UPDATE table_name SET column1 = val
原创 2024-03-01 05:28:53
98阅读
本文将和大家分享 MySQL 更新语句一些小众语法,及笔者在使用多表关联更新遇到一些问题。先来看单表更新语法:UPDATE [LOW_PRIORITY] [IGNORE] table_reference     SET assignment_list     [WHERE where_condition]     [ORDER BY ...]     [LIMIT row_count]大家可
转载 2021-01-25 18:43:05
1542阅读
2评论
**ASP 更新 MySQL语句** ASP(Active Server Pages)是一种用于开发交互式网站服务器端脚本语言,而MySQL是一种流行数据库管理系统。在ASP中,我们可以使用一些语句更新MySQL数据库中数据。本文将介绍如何使用ASP编写代码来更新MySQL数据库语句,并提供相关代码示例。 ## 准备工作 在开始编写代码之前,确保已经安装了以下软件和工具: 1
原创 2023-09-27 14:00:18
34阅读
很多时候,我们需要导入一张表数据到另一张表,那么我们就可以用到批量更新,如下:UPDATE [table1] SET name=b.name ,sex=b.sex ,remark=b.remark FROM [table1] INNER JOIN dbo.table2 b ON name=b.name另外,如果需要条件,直接增加WHERE +条件 就 ok!
转载 2023-06-26 15:11:49
561阅读
MySQL中有六种日志文件 分别是:重做日志(redo log)、回滚日志(undo log)、二进制日志(binlog)、错误日志(errorlog)、慢查询日志(slow query log)、一般查询日志(general log),中继日志(relay log)。其中重做日志,回滚日志和二进制日志与事务操作相关。要想深入理解MySQL事务,对这三种日志理解,必不可少。重做日志,回滚日志
转载 2024-06-17 15:06:31
30阅读
1.更新语句执行流程概述MySQL三大日志详解经过上一篇文章MySQL基础架构与查询语句执行过程,对于一条SQL执行过程有了大致了解。MySQL执行查询语句与执行更新(统称,包括插入、删除、修改等)过程基本相同,但是也有不同,不同地方下面重点讲解。执行更新语句大致流程。首先要连接数据库(连接器工作),然后因为是一个更新操作,会将缓存中跟这个表有关所有缓存全部失效,然后经过分析器通过
转载 2023-08-21 18:10:35
132阅读
从项目中迅速定位执行速度慢语句(定义慢查询),然后优化1、首先我们了解mysql数据库一些运行状态如何查询(mysql运行时间、一共执行了多少次select update detele 当前连接) 指定:show status常用:show status like 'uptime' 查询运行时间show status like 'com_select'  show status
更新语句涉及模块:连接器建立连接、分析器解析语句要做什么、优化器得出怎么做,执行器调用存储器执行命令,redo log:重做日志,bin log:归档日志1、redo log[存储引擎有的日志]当业务繁忙时,执行一次更新语句 要到库表中若干个记录中查询要更新记录,再执行更新操作,整个过程IO成本,查找成本都很高。所以mysql这样做:当有一条记录要更新时,InnoDB先将记录写到 redo
日志系统:一条SQL更新语句是如何执行?一、更新语句执行流程MySQL可以恢复到半个月内任意一秒状态。如何做到?更新语句同样会把查询语句流程走一遍。连接器连接客户端—>在一个表上有更新时候,跟这个表有关查询缓存会失效(不建议使用查询缓存)—>分析器根据语法分析得知是更新语句–>优化器决定执行索引—>执行器负责执行找到这一行后更新更新流程还涉及到redo log(重
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及列上建立索引。 2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描,如:select id from t where num is null可以在num上设置默认值0,确保表中num列没有null值,然后这样查询:select id from t
# MySQL 更新语句更新最新时间 在开发过程中,我们经常需要更新数据库中数据,并且保持其中时间戳为最新时间。MySQL是一个广泛使用关系型数据库管理系统,非常适合用于处理大量数据更新操作。本文将介绍如何使用MySQL更新语句更新最新时间,并提供相关代码示例。 ## 更新语句更新最新时间 在MySQL中,可以使用UPDATE语句更新数据库中数据。要更新最新时间,我们可以使
原创 2024-07-01 03:41:18
46阅读
一条SQL更新语句执行过程?redo log --InnoDB持有的日志binlog --Server层日志两阶段提交在什么场景下,一天一备会比一周一备更有优势呢? 更新一个简单sql语句mysql> update user set age='23' where id='1';在上一章中查询流程,更新流程基本会走一遍。区别在于:分析器区别出这是一条更新语句;优化器使用当前id
MySQL数据库增删改查常用语句详解一 MySQL数据库表结构1.1 常见数据类型1.2 常用约束类型1.3 MySQL存储引擎二 DDL语句:数据定义语句2.1 修改数据库密码2.1.1 创建登录用户2.1.2 给用户授权登录2.1.3 测试用户登录2.1.4 修改用户自身密码2.1.5 root用户更改其他用户密码2.1.6 root找回密码及修改2.2 查看数据库结构2.3 创建和删除数据
转载 2024-07-28 14:52:28
134阅读
数据是什么数:数字信息据:属性或某种凭据数据:对一些列对对象具体属性描述信息集合。数据库是什么数据库:就是用来组织 (按照规则组织起来) ,存储和管理 (对数据增、删、改、查) 数据仓库。数据库是企业重要信息资产。使用数据库时要注意(查和增无所谓,但是删和改要谨慎!)数据库管理系统(DBMS):实现对数据有效组织,管理和存取系统软件mysql工作过程和数据流向图:数据库组成数据
转载 2024-06-06 00:09:52
54阅读
  • 1
  • 2
  • 3
  • 4
  • 5